Output 95c8751a942c0748a31f50e8002843b7a77bce62fa61a193d4cacd258aa53a9c:1

value
188846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62bd2a80e8133adf64d4af8e749ae09ecb1235c OP_EQUAL
address
3KkrDPkSTmbxZgdPnddZ9rYESyuDygDm2Q
transaction
95c8751a942c0748a31f50e8002843b7a77bce62fa61a193d4cacd258aa53a9c
confirmations
336669
spent
true